B.Tech Civil Engineering at NSUT is a 4 years, Full Time Degree program offered On Campus.

  • The total fees for the B.Tech Civil Engineering program at NSUT is ₹ 11.29 Lakhs.
  • Students need to pay ₹ 2.5 Lakhs in the first year.

Admissions to B.Tech Civil Engineering at NSUT are primarily based on JAC-Delhi. Candidates must have completed 10+2 with 60% + JEE Main to be eligible for admission. The overall JAC-Delhi cutoff for the B.Tech Civil Engineering program is 18505 - 1106765 across all categories. Check NSUT Admission

According to Collegedunia Engineering Ranking 2026, NSUT ranks 36 out of 500 colleges in India with an overall score of 375 out of 1000. India Today Engineering ranking 2025, ranks NSUT at 8 out of 269 in India.

NSUT B.Tech Civil Engineering Fees

B.Tech Civil Engineering Fees at NSUT covers a range of expenses, including tuition fee, course materials, and access to campus facilities.
  • The total fees for B.Tech Civil Engineering is ₹ 11.29 Lakhs.
  • This includes a total tuition fee of ₹ 11.29 Lakhs.
  • Candidates need to pay ₹ 2.5 Lakhs in the first year.

Earlier, B.Tech Civil Engineering fees at NSUT was ₹ 10.5 Lakhs (in 2024) for the entire course duration. This shows a fee increase of ₹ 79,000 over the year.

Are courses in DTU and NSIT flexible? Can students from lower branches study a minor in C.S. easily?

Akriti Banerjeelives in New Delhi

As an NSUT student, the new CBCS (choice based credit system) allows you to choose your fields of study. This makes for more flexible courses. Also, NSUT has an excellent coding environment which will help you for your minor in Computer Science. Many students over there pursue coding, despite being from a branch other than IT/COE. 

In DTU, you will have electives starting from 5th semester.These are department and general electives. IIIT Delhi offers the most flexible courses. Other than some fixed category credits, all the subjects are choice based. 

Thus, in terms of providing flexible courses, this is the order of preference- IIITD> NSUT>DTU.
